Warranty

GENERAC POWER SYSTEMS STANDARD TWO-YEAR BASIC 

LIMITED WARRANTY FOR STANDBY POWER SYSTEMS

NOTE:  ALL UNITS MUST HAVE A START-UP INSPECTION PERFORMED BY AN AUTHORIZED GENERAC DEALER.

For a period of two (2) years or two thousand (2,000) hours of operation from the date of start up, which ever occurs first, Generac Power Systems, Inc. (Generac) will, at its option, 

repair or replace any part(s) which, upon examination, inspection, and testing by Generac or an Authorized/Certified Generac Dealer, or branch thereof, is found to be defective under 

normal use and service, in accordance with the warranty schedule set forth below. Repair or replacement pursuant to this limited warranty shall not renew or extend the original warranty 

period.  Any repaired product shall be warranted for the remaining original warranty period only.  Any equipment that the purchaser/owner claims to be defective must be examined by the 

nearest Authorized/Certified Generac Dealer, or branch thereof. This warranty applies only to Generac Generators used in "Standby" applications, as Generac has defined Standby, provided 

said generator has been initially installed and/or inspected on-site by an Authorized/Certified Generac Dealer, or branch thereof. It is highly recommended that scheduled maintenance, as 

outlined by the generator owner’s  manual, be performed by an Authorized/Certified Generac Dealer, or branch thereof.  This will verify service has been performed on the unit throughout 

the warranty period. This warranty is limited to and available only on Liquid-cooled units.

***This warranty only applies to units sold for use in the US and Canada.***

WARRANTY SCHEDULE

YEAR ONE — Limited comprehensive coverage on mileage, labor, and parts listed.

• ALL COMPONENTS — ENGINE, ALTERNATOR AND TRANSFER SWITCH

YEAR TWO — Limited comprehensive coverage on parts listed.

• ALL COMPONENTS — ENGINE, ALTERNATOR AND TRANSFER SWITCH PARTS ONLY

GEARBOX EQUIPPED UNITS - LIMITED GEARBOX COVERAGE

YEARS ONE THROUGH FIVE — Parts and labor coverage on gearbox and components.

YEARS SIX THROUGH TEN — Parts only coverage on gearbox and components.

GUIDELINES:

1.  Travel allowance is limited to 300 miles maximum, and 7.5 hours maximum (per occurrence), round trip, to the nearest authorized Generac Service Facility.

2.  Warranty only applies to permanently wired and mounted units.

3.  All warranty repairs, must be performed and/or addressed by an Authorized/Certified Generac Dealer, or branch thereof.

4.   A Generac Transfer Switch is highly recommended to be used in conjunction with the generator set. If a Non-Generac Transfer Switch is substituted for use and directly causes dam-

age to the generator set, no warranty coverage shall apply.

5.  All warranty expense allowances are subject to the conditions defined in Generac’s General Service Policy Manual.

6.  Units that have been resold are not covered under the Generac Warranty, as this Warranty is not transferable.

7.  Unit enclosure is only covered during the first year of the warranty provision.

8.  Use of Non-Generac replacement part(s) will void the warranty in its entirety.

9.  Engine coolant heaters (block-heaters), heater controls and circulating pumps are only covered during the first year of the warranty provision.

10.  Generac may chose to Repair, Replace or Refund a piece of equipment.

11.   Warranty Labor Rates are based on normal working hours.  Additional costs for overtime, holiday or emergency labor costs for repairs outside of normal business hours will be the 

responsibility of the customer.

12.  Warranty Parts shipment costs are reimbursed at ground shipment rates.  Costs related to requests for expedited shipping will be the responsibility of the customer.

13.  Batteries are warranted by the battery manufacturer.

14.  Verification of required maintenance may be required for warranty coverage.
